准备工作
1. 安装MYSQL数据库:首先需要在服务器上安装MYSQL数据库,并创建相应的数据库和表结构。
2. 配置开发环境:安装JSP开发环境,包括JDK(Java Development Kit)和WEB服务器如Tomcat等。
3. 连接工具:确保有适当的JDBC(Java Database Connectivity)驱动,以便JSP页面能够与MYSQL数据库进行通信。
整合JSP与MYSQL
1. 数据库连接:在JSP页面中,通过JDBC连接MYSQL数据库。这需要在页面中编写相应的Java代码,使用MYSQL的JDBC驱动来建立连接。
2. 数据交互:通过SQL语句实现与数据库的交互,如增删改查等操作。这些SQL语句可以在JSP页面中直接编写,也可以放在Java Bean中处理。
3. 页面渲染:JSP页面负责前端的渲染,通过Java代码与数据库交互获取数据,然后以HTML的形式展示给用户。
具体实现步骤
1. 在JSP页面中导入MYSQL的JDBC驱动。
2. 编写Java代码,建立与MYSQL数据库的连接。这需要提供数据库的URL、用户名和密码等信息。
3. 编写SQL语句,实现数据的增删改查等操作。这些操作可以通过Java代码直接在JSP页面中完成,也可以调用Java Bean中的方法来实现。
4. 将从数据库中获取的数据以HTML的形式展示在页面上。这可以通过JSP的标签和表达式来实现。
5. 对页面进行测试和调试,确保数据的正确性和页面的稳定性。
注意事项
1. 数据库安全:确保数据库的连接信息(如用户名、密码等)不被泄露,以防止未经授权的访问。
2. 数据备份:定期对数据库进行备份,以防数据丢失或损坏。
3. 性能优化:对数据库和JSP页面进行性能优化,以提高网站的响应速度和用户体验。
4. 错误处理:对可能的错误进行妥善处理,如数据库连接失败、SQL语句错误等,以确保网站的稳定性。